Cobblestone Installation in Longmont, CO
Cobblestone installation services involve laying durable, natural stone pavers to create attractive and functional surfaces for driveways, walkways, patios, and landscaping features. This process typically includes preparing the ground, designing the layout, and carefully placing each stone to ensure stability and aesthetic appeal. Property owners often request cobblestone installation to enhance curb appeal, add a timeless look to outdoor spaces, or improve the durability of pathways and surfaces exposed to regular foot or vehicle traffic.
Before requesting cobblestone installation, homeowners should consider the scope of the project, including the size and shape of the area to be covered, as well as the style and color of the stones. It’s also helpful to understand the ground conditions, drainage requirements, and any necessary permits or regulations that may apply. Clarifying these details can help ensure the finished surface meets both aesthetic preferences and practical needs for longevity and performance.

Cobblestone Installation Questions
What types of projects are suitable for cobblestone installation? Cobblestone is ideal for pathways, driveways, patios, and decorative accents around a property.
How long does cobblestone installation typically last? Properly installed cobblestone surfaces can last for decades with minimal maintenance.
Are there specific design options available with cobblestone? Yes, cobblestones come in various colors, sizes, and patterns to match different aesthetic preferences.
What should property owners consider before installing cobblestone? It's important to evaluate the existing landscape and drainage to ensure a durable and functional installation.
